Chapter 74: I Am Not a Devil...

"Dad! Save me..."

Zheng Lili looked up from the floor, her face swollen and streaked with tears. When she saw the portly, pot-bellied figure of her father, Zheng Hongji, her eyes immediately filled with hope.

That was her father. A big shot in the jewelry industry of Modu. A billionaire who commanded respect. Her shield against the world.

Zheng Hongji looked down at his only daughter, kneeling on the cold mall floor, her cheeks red and swollen, covered in the stark imprint of handprints.

A look of intense heartache flashed in his eyes. No father wanted to see his child in such a state.

But then he looked at Shen Anyu. And his heart, which had been aching for his daughter, suddenly felt as heavy as lead, sinking into the pit of his stomach.

The young man stood there calmly, radiating an aura of absolute authority that made the air around him feel thin.

How? How did his foolish daughter manage to anger this one? Of all the people in Modu, of all the people in Yanxia, why him?

Seeing her father arrive, Zheng Lili mistook his silence for anger on her behalf. She immediately gained confidence, her voice shrill and demanding.

"Dad! I've been bullied! You must help me get revenge! This bastard pretty boy... he actually dared to have people hit me! He made me kneel!"

"You must help me get revenge on him! Make him pay the price! I want to make him regret being born!"

SLAP!

The sound was sharp, echoing through the silent corridor.

Zheng Lili's hateful words were cut short as a heavy hand landed on her face, snapping her head to the side.

Zheng Lili was stunned. Her head spun, her ears ringing. She touched her cheek, disbelief washing over her.

What made it even harder for her to believe was the source of the blow. It wasn't the martial arts master. It wasn't Shen Anyu.

It was her most doting father, Zheng Hongji.

How could this be?

Her father had never hit her before! Not once in her life!

"Dad... you hit me? You actually hit me?!"

Zheng Lili screamed hysterically, full of disbelief and betrayal.

"When Mom passed away, what did you say? You promised! You said you'd take good care of me for the rest of my life, hold me in your palm like a precious jewel! And now you're hitting me?!"

Zheng Hongji looked at her, his hand still raised, trembling slightly. He seemed to have aged ten years in that single moment. He sighed, a sound of profound defeat.

"I spoiled you too much, Lili. I protected you from the world, and it led to today's disaster!"

Ignoring her incredulous expression, Zheng Hongji turned towards Shen Anyu.

And then, the billionaire jewelry tycoon, a man who commanded thousands, knelt down.

Thud.

His knees hit the floor with a heavy sound. He trembled as he bowed his head, not daring to look Shen Anyu in the eye.

"Young Master Shen... I only have this one daughter. She is foolish. She is spoiled."

"She offended you. I know this is unforgivable."

"Please... give her a way out. Spare her life."

"I, Zheng Hongji, am willing to pay any price! My fortune, my company, anything!"

"Please!"

Thud. Thud. Thud.

Zheng Hongji began kowtowing, his forehead hitting the floor with a dull rhythm.

At this moment, the entire place was silent. Even the sounds of breathing and heartbeats seemed to vanish. There was only the sound of Zheng Hongji's continuous kowtowing and begging for mercy.

Zheng Lili was dumbfounded. She stared blankly at this scene, her brain unable to process the image.

In her memory, her father was majestic. He was the undisputed leader of the Modu jewelry industry. He walked with his head held high. Even high-ranking officials chatted and laughed with him.

Over the years, the [Zheng Family Jewelry Company] had flourished under his management. It was his kingdom.

It was with such backing that Zheng Lili could be so arrogant. She thought she was a princess.

But she never expected that her biggest pillar of support, her invincible father, would actually kneel before that "pretty boy"? How could this be?

Especially seeing her father pale and drenched in cold sweat, that expression of utter reverence and fear... it made Zheng Lili feel as if her world was collapsing.

Liu Mi stood by Shen Anyu's side, her beautiful eyes sparkling brighter than diamonds. Her heart pounded in her chest.

She knew. She knew that it was all because of the man beside her. He possessed immense power, a power so vast that even a tycoon like Zheng Hongji had to bow down in terror.

Shen Anyu looked calmly at Zheng Hongji, who was kneeling and kowtowing. His expression was indifferent, devoid of pity or malice.

"The hearts of all parents are pitiful," he said softly.

"But Zheng Lili's situation today is also your own doing, Zheng Hongji. You spoiled her too much. You created this monster."

"Even if she hadn't run into me today, she would have caused trouble eventually. Someone else might not have been as... patient."

Upon hearing this, Zheng Hongji was filled with even greater remorse. He trembled, his voice thick with emotion.

"Young Master Shen, I know I was wrong. I failed as a father."

"Please, deal with me as you see fit! Punish me, but spare her!"

Facing the behemoth that was Shen Anyu, backed by the [Yanxia Shen Family] and the [Yanxia An Family], Zheng Hongji had no thought of resisting. Resistance was death. He could only obediently admit his mistake and await his punishment.

"Young Master Shen...?"

Zheng Lili whispered the name. She wasn't a complete fool. The pieces finally clicked together.

At this moment, she recalled the rumors of the top noble who had arrived in Modu. Her face turned drastically pale, the blood draining away until she looked like a ghost. Her body broke out in a cold sweat.

She never dreamed that the "pretty boy" she had been insulting, the man she tried to force into submission, was actually the Young Master of the Yanxia Shen Family.

She... she actually offended such an existence?

As soon as she thought of this, Zheng Lili's face turned ashen. Her eyes filled with despair. She didn't even dare to breathe too loudly.

She looked pitifully at Shen Anyu, awaiting her punishment, no longer daring to utter a single word of defiance. Her arrogance had evaporated.

Shen Anyu smiled. He didn't even glance at Zheng Lili. She was beneath his notice. He looked at Liu Mi beside him and said lightly:

"Today, I'm in a good mood because I'm on a date with Mi Mi. So you guys are lucky."

Upon hearing this, Liu Mi felt a surge of sweetness in her heart.

So she held such a position in Shen Anyu's heart? He spared them because of her?

[Ding! Detected Destiny Value +6 from Destined Heroine Liu Mi, plundering +18,000 Destiny Points!]

[Ding! Detected total favorability of Destined Heroine Liu Mi at 85, plundering +30,000 Destiny Points!]

Shen Anyu had only habitually spoken sweet words just now, but seeing the points roll in, he was genuinely in a good mood.

With a pleasant expression, he held Liu Mi's fair, delicate hand and turned to walk out.

Zheng Hongji and Zheng Lili immediately breathed a sigh of relief, their bodies sagging as if they had just walked back from the gates of hell.

However, just then, Shen Anyu stopped. He didn't turn around, but his faint words echoed in their ears, cold and absolute.

"Zheng Hongji. I don't want to see Zheng Lili again. In this city."

"Yes! Yes, Young Master Shen!"

Zheng Hongji's heart jolted, and he quickly responded respectfully.

He had already decided. He would put his daughter under house arrest when they returned home. She would never leave for the rest of her life if she had to. He would send her abroad, to a convent, anywhere away from Modu to avoid causing a disaster that would wipe out their family.

Shen Anyu continued, his voice casual.

"[Zheng Family Jewelry Company] has developed quite well. I want to become a major shareholder."

Upon hearing Shen Anyu's words, Zheng Hongji's expression changed drastically.

A major shareholder?

These were shares worth tens of billions. Even he only held less than half of the [Zheng Family Jewelry Company]'s shares directly.

If he gave them up... control of the company would no longer be in his hands. He would lose his life's work.

However, looking at Shen Anyu's back, feeling the cold gaze that seemed to pierce through him even without eye contact... Zheng Hongji nodded with difficulty.

"Young Master Shen... no problem."

"I will transfer the shares to you... for one yuan... later!"

Zheng Hongji's face was ashen. It hurt. It hurt like cutting off a limb. But he thought that it was better than his family being ruined under the pressure of the [Shen Corporation]. Better to lose the company than lose their lives.

Shen Anyu paused. Then, he laughed softly.

"I'm not a devil or anything."

"Don't worry, Zheng Hongji. I will acquire the corresponding shares at market price. I don't steal."

"Zheng Hongji, although you are incapable of raising a daughter, your ability to manage a company is quite extraordinary. I acknowledge that."

"The [Zheng Family Jewelry Company] will reach new heights after joining the [Shen Corporation]. Consider it... a promotion."

Although Shen Anyu could directly take over the company by force, doing so would be too unsightly. It would cause other wealthy magnates to feel a sense of dread, creating unnecessary instability.

Although Shen Anyu was not afraid, there were better ways to handle it. Smart ways.

The [Zheng Family Jewelry Company] in Zheng Hongji's hands was only worth a few hundred million ten years ago, but it had flourished under his management, developing very quickly.

He wanted not only the golden eggs but also the hen that laid them. He wanted Zheng Hongji working for him.

Besides, Shen Anyu had not forgotten that he also had a batch of top-tier jewelry obtained from the System's lottery—items that could easily be considered museum treasures. He needed a distribution channel.

"Young Master Shen... thank you! Thank you for your great generosity!"

Upon hearing this, Zheng Hongji was overjoyed. He repeatedly thanked Shen Anyu, bowing deeply.

His emotions swung wildly from despair to elation. He had thought everything was over, that he would be destitute. But he never expected Shen Anyu to show such leniency, to offer market price, to keep him on board.

He was immediately moved to tears of gratitude.

Shen Anyu found it amusing in his heart.

Look. Zheng Hongji was even saying thank you for being conquered.

This was the art of the Villain.
